1. He’s a Tufts University Graduate and a True Explorer at Heart
Born in Manchester-by-the-Sea, Massachusetts, Josh Gates graduated from Tufts University, where he majored in archaeology and drama — a fitting combination for someone who now brings ancient mysteries to life on screen.
He’s also a member of The Explorers Club, an elite group of world travelers and researchers dedicated to scientific exploration.
Josh is the author of the book Destination Truth: Memoirs of a Monster Hunter and has appeared on programs like The Today Show and CNN to discuss his adventures.
Talking to Monsters and Critics, he explained what drives his passion:
“We’re looking for stories with a compelling legend or mystery — but also where there’s something real happening. We love working with archaeologists and explorers who are on the cusp of discovery.”
2. He’s Married to Hallie Gnatovich — a Therapist and Former TV Colleague
Josh met his wife, Hallie Gnatovich, while filming Destination Truth. The pair got engaged on set and later married on September 13, 2014.
They share a son named Owen.
Hallie is a licensed marriage and family therapist, according to her LinkedIn profile, and has worked in private practice since 2009. Before that, she served as a consultant for MedAvante.
She graduated from Oberlin College in 2004 with a degree in theatre.
Although the two later separated, Josh has spoken fondly about their years together and their shared journey through television and family life.
3. His Sense of Humor Doesn’t Always Land — and He Owns It
Josh is known for his quick wit on camera, but he admits that his jokes don’t always hit their mark.
“I think my sense of humor falls flat all the time,” he told Monsters and Critics. “But you have to have one when you’re doing this kind of work — or it’ll grind you down. Because as anyone who travels knows, nothing ever goes exactly the way you expect.”
His self-awareness and humor have made him one of the most relatable adventurers on TV.

4. He’s an Avid Scuba Diver and Passionate Photographer
Beyond his work on camera, Josh Gates is an experienced scuba diver and underwater explorer. His expeditions have taken him across the globe — from Antarctica’s icy shores to the peaks of Mt. Kilimanjaro and Aconcagua in South America.
He’s also a skilled photographer, often sharing stunning behind-the-scenes shots from his travels, showcasing the wild beauty of the places he explores.
5. He’s Hosted Other Hit Shows — Including ‘The Trip: 2016’
Before Expedition Unknown became a global hit, Josh made his mark on television as the host and co-executive producer of Syfy’s Destination Truth.
In 2016, he also co-hosted The Trip on the Travel Channel — a special series that explored the cultures, cuisines, and hidden luxuries of five Caribbean islands.
